The Autowatch Ghost is the first aftermarket CANbus immobiliser. It can be connected to the vehicle's wiring and to the engine control unit (ECU). The device is able to intercept signals and prevent your car from starting normally until you enter a customized code. The system can be turned off or on through your smartphone's app, without the need for additional wires.

Standard factory immobilisers in vehicles work by having a transponder built into the key, which sends an indication to the ECU. If the correct code is sent the car will start, but if a transponder is swapped with one from a different vehicle, the immobiliser will not recognise it. This makes it possible for the vehicle to be stolen and started. A South African company that is at the forefront of vehicle safety systems technology developed the Ghost immobiliser. It shields you from hacking or key cloning and even key theft. Only by physically towing your vehicle away could a thief get it, and they would still not be able to drive the vehicle.

Ghost utilizes the buttons of your car, such as the indicator stalk as well as the steering wheel and door panels to generate a unique PIN code that is changeable that must be entered prior to you can use your car. This is performed without the need for extra hardware such as a key-fob and can last up to 20 presses long. It is also inaccessible to diagnostic equipment and doesn't transmit radio frequency signals, so thieves are not able to utilize sophisticated RF scanning or code-grabbing technology to determine if the security system has been installed.

Contrary to other security systems which rely on a relay in the engine bay, these CANBUS immobilisers communicate via CAN databus (brand dependent) with the ECU and BCM of the vehicle. This allows them to block a vehicle completely, by sending a digital block to the ECU and engine.

It is also possible to connect a separate analog immobiliser, alarm, or tracker to these systems, but this has to be specified before installing the device. They are also service/valet mode-compatible and a great alternative to a tracker if you are you have your car checked for an electrical fault at the dealers.

It directly communicates with your car's ECU (Engine Control Unit) through the data loop of CAN. It's completely silent since it doesn't use radio frequencies or key fobs. It can't be detected by diagnostics or any other hacking device. It also prevents the user from using the new ECU or key to bypass the system, because only the PIN number allows the engine to start.

The device is hidden within your car, using buttons on the steering wheel, the centre console and door panels. Before you can begin your vehicle, you must enter a unique, changeable PIN number that is up to 20 numbers.

This is the very first aftermarket CAN-bus immobiliser that is being designed. It can prevent your vehicle from being started or driven if you don't enter a PIN code first. If you're driving away with the device in motion, an indicator will appear on your dashboard which will flash continuously for approximately 300m. Entering your PIN code will deactivate the anti-hijack. Your car will continue to function normally. If you do not enter your PIN code at this point, the warning will continue to flash and require a new PIN code for every attempt to start your vehicle.
